Re: Help required to integrate openmeetings api

2020-06-02 Thread Maxim Solodovnik
Hello,

If you re-read https://support.google.com/a/answer/176600?hl=en

You will find 3 possible ways

I usually choose "Gmail SMTP server"

And you will need to create and use App password
https://support.google.com/mail/answer/185833


AFAIK regular web UI password will not work ...

Re: Help required to integrate openmeetings api

2020-05-31 Thread Alvaro
Hi Pooja,
Your mail configuration is similar to this?
Mail-Refer == j...@gmail.com
SMTP-Server == smtp.gmail.com
SMTP-Server Port (defaultSmtp-Server Port is 25)) == 587
SMTP-Username == j...@gmail.com
SMTP-Userpass == password of j...@gmail.com
Enable TLS in Mail Server Auth == ...turn green the button to activate
